Discover New Graphic Worlds with SVG

Scalable Vector Graphics (SVG), the next groundbreaking graphics and animation tool for computer imaging--allows designers to create fast-loading Web graphics that can be viewed equally well on a Web browser, a handheld computer, or a cell phone. SVG For Designers fully explains the technology, and offers a practical, easy-to-follow guide to its many uses for graphic designers. Learn why SVG-based graphics and Web pages can save time and money, improve quality, and revolutionize the way Web graphics convey information. Take advantage of SVG's open-standard platform and resolution-independent technology--with minimal cost for new software or training, whether you're in publishing, graphic arts, Web design, or production.Learn SVG--the first standardized way to create Web graphics and animation Create fast-loading XML-based images that can be viewed on screens of any size Create SVG images with the programs you're already using, including Adobe Illustrator and CorelDRAW Convey multimedia content over the Web--with or without Flash files Achieve better quality and greater precision for many types of illustrations and artwork Complement Web bitmap formats like JPEG and GIF with the sharpness and quick-loading advantages of SVG Create, modify, and implement SVG graphics in other applications--including Photoshop, Flash, and Illustrator
